logo

Output d2fa50f837acc4e4477b1997e632a8c6a9fa95066d1f261f95ade75574dea688:1

value
569920867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1266e42f1dfed6b8379af787fa966c9d11c9e62 OP_EQUAL
address
3Pg6ozDj49q58EwjqnVZSpbQDkxnQ7sw82
transaction
d2fa50f837acc4e4477b1997e632a8c6a9fa95066d1f261f95ade75574dea688